He was well known to many city and county employees during the time his son-in-law was custodian at the courthouse. He was born in Denmark, July 18, 1858. He moved to Dwight, Ill, at the age of 25 and moved to Ionia January 11, 1907. He had made his home with the Dahls since 1927. Petersen’s wife preceded him in death in Ionia October 16, 1929. He was a retired farmer. Surviving are two daughters, Mrs. Charley Dahl of Ionia and Mrs. T. L. Richards of Chicago, Ill.; two granddaughters; one great-granddaughter; one step-son, Sigvert Nelson of Angola, Iowa; one step-daughter, Mrs. Frank Zellar of Campus, Ill.; three brothers in Denmark. Funeral services will be held at the Evangelical U.B. church, where he was a member, at 2 p.m. Saturday. The Rev. A. R. Kuehn will officiate. Interment will be in Highland Park cemetery. The body will repose at the family home until an hour before the services.
